How Do I Fix Tchia Low FPS Issue?

Here are some solutions that would help you in fixing the Tchia Low FPS or stuttering issues. You are mainly required to perform some customizations with the system OS.

Because this isn’t a game bug, but only your game is getting less amount of the resources that are required for a smooth launch and gameplay.

Dedicate Tchia Manually

If any of the Tchia players face difficulty in using GPU, they should select it manually from their respective GPU managers.

I have talked about NVIDIA and AMD users individually, in the following section:

NVIDIA:

1. Launch NVIDIA Control Panel.

2. Navigate to 3D Settings >> Manage 3D Settings

3. Go to Program Settings and add Tchia

4. Choose a High-performance NVIDIA processor

5. After saving the changes, restart your PC.

AMD:

1. Launch AMD Radeon Settings

2. Navigate to System and select Switchable Graphics

3. Restart your system.

Update Graphics Drivers

Always ensure that your device drivers are updated to the latest build. Especially, your graphics drivers should be updated to the latest patch.

Update GPU Drivers
1. Press the Win + X keys to launch the context menu.

2. Select Device Manager from the appearing menu.

3. Expand the Display Adapters tab.

4. Right-click on the GPU device and select Update Driver

5. Allow the system to update the files automatically.

Exit Unwanted Background Tasks

Some background running apps can intercept your Tchia gameplay. It would be better to only run the game and remove all the background apps/processes.

1. Launch Task Manager from the context menu bar (press Win + X keys to launch the context menu)

2. Go to the processes tab.

3. Choose the unwanted apps and click on the End Task button.

Customize In-Game Settings

In-game optimization can also be helpful in fixing the issues related to GPU.

Here’s what you need to do to make Tchia run smoothly on your computer.

1. From the Tchia lobby, click on the Settings icon.

2. Turn off VSync

3. Shift advanced settings to low or medium.

Repair Tchia Files

If you are still unable to launch Tchia, you should consider repairing its files from the game launcher. This would help you in fixing any corruptions and faults in the game’s files, that are caused by the faulty third-party apps.

1. Launch Steam and navigate to the Library section

2. Right-click on Tchia and select Properties

3. Go to the Local Files tab

4. Click on Verify the integrity of game files.

Reinstall Tchia

You should also try reinstalling Tchia, as it will help you in removing all the clutters from the game’s directory.

1. So while using Steam, right-click on Tchia and select Manage

2. Now, click on the Uninstall option.

3. Once the game is removed from the library, reinstall it.
